Block-based AI fashion photographyRAWSHOT AI generates original on-model fashion images and short videos from selectable models, garments, lighting, backgrounds, poses and camera compositions.
RAWSHOT AI turns the shoot into seven visible, selectable building blocks rather than an empty text box. Users can save the complete configuration as a Stack and apply the same model, styling, lighting and composition logic across hundreds of products, while retaining control over every setting.
RAWSHOT AI is designed for apparel, footwear and accessories teams that need repeatable imagery without coordinating physical samples, casting or studio scheduling. The platform offers more than 1,800 licence-free synthetic models, including more than 600 children's models; all are synthetic composites, and no child was cast, photographed or used as a likeness reference. Saved Stacks preserve selected treatments for catalogue-scale production, while the browser interface and REST API support anything from one image to 10,000 or more per run.
The main tradeoff is controlled selection rather than open-ended creative direction: RAWSHOT AI ships one accuracy-focused image style and provides no free-text input. A DTC label can upload a collection, select a consistent model and treatment, then generate repeatable product imagery for a seasonal drop. Still images reach 2K or 4K, while video supports up to three five-second scenes at 720p or 1080p.

insMind
SMBCreates AI product photos, backgrounds, and advertising visuals from source images.
AI Product Photography combines product upload, scenario selection, and automatic scene generation in one browser editor.
Small brands can upload a product, select a visual scenario, and generate several promotional compositions from the same source image. Reference-image conditioning helps preserve the product while insMind changes the surrounding setting, lighting, and presentation. The editor also supports transparent cutouts, custom backgrounds, text overlays, and resizing for social or store placements.
The main tradeoff is limited production control compared with specialist studio workflows that provide detailed camera, lighting, and color parameters. Generated details can require manual review when packaging text, logos, reflective materials, or complex edges must remain exact. insMind works well for merchants producing campaign variations, marketplace images, and seasonal scenes without arranging repeated photo shoots.

Pixelcut
SMBGenerates product backgrounds, scenes, and promotional images from uploaded product photos.
AI masking that preserves product cutouts while generating consistent staged variants across batches.
Pixelcut’s workflow starts from a provided product image and then applies automated segmentation to separate the subject from the background for downstream edits. The generator output is geared toward product photography automation, including background replacement, shadow handling, and aspect-ratio variants for listing pages. Generated images are produced in batches, which helps teams standardize hero image generation and catalog image generation at volume.
A key tradeoff is dependency on good input photos for strong product fidelity, since the system must preserve edges, logos, and material boundaries from the starting shot. It fits best when teams need repeatable staging across many SKUs rather than one-off creative images from scratch.

How to Choose the Right ai product shoot photography generator
An ai product shoot photography generator turns a product image into consistent staged scenes, background replacements, and variant-ready catalog assets without rebuilding every shoot setup from scratch. This guide covers RAWSHOT AI, insMind, Pixelcut, Flair AI, Picsart, Blend, Vmake AI, SellerSprite, Eva AI, and Photoroom based on how each tool handles repeatability, control, and workflow fit.
The ordering favors tools that convert the shoot plan into reusable configuration and high-throughput batch output, especially RAWSHOT AI’s Stack-based approach and Pixelcut’s masking-first variant consistency. Tools also differ in whether they support precise product masking from an input photo or instead rely on scene generation that can shift fine logos, text, and materials.
AI product shoot photography generator for catalog-ready staged scenes and variants
An ai product shoot photography generator creates e-commerce image variants by generating staged scenes around an uploaded product, then applying consistent backgrounds, shadows, and composition choices across multiple outputs. Some tools keep the product as a visual anchor using product masking and batch processing, which is the core pattern in Pixelcut and Flair AI.
Other tools shift toward guided full-editor workflows where product upload plus scenario selection becomes automatic scene generation, which is how insMind packages its upload-to-scenes flow. RAWSHOT AI takes a different approach by turning the shoot configuration into selectable building blocks that can be saved as a Stack for repeating the same styling, lighting, and composition logic across hundreds of products.
Repeatability, control surfaces, and export throughput for product shoot generation
A product shoot generator matters most when the same studio plan must be applied across many SKUs with predictable staging, product placement, and background consistency. Tools that convert inputs into reusable configurations reduce per-product rework and keep visual sets aligned.
Control depth also determines how often human review must fix logos, packaging text, shadows, and reflections. Masking-first workflows and reference-image conditioning generally protect the product identity better than free-form scene generation.

Choose a workflow that matches how products, branding, and variants must stay consistent
Selection should start with what must remain invariant across variants. If product identity must hold up under staged scenes, prioritize masking-first or reference-image conditioning tools that keep edges stable and reduce logo and text drift.
Next, align the workflow model with the team’s production cadence. High-throughput catalog updates benefit from batch generation, while recurring campaign kits benefit from configuration reuse that can be applied across many products without re-tuning prompts.
